Software Architect
CrowdboticsFull Time
Expert & Leadership (9+ years)
The Principal Software Engineer should have extensive experience in software development, with the ability to make key technical decisions and implement large software projects. Candidates must be ambitious, able to take ownership of projects, lead them to completion with ambiguity, and balance speed and quality. A strong understanding of how to create the most impact and a fast learning ability to familiarize with complex products and codebases are essential. Experience with frontend, backend, or full-stack development is required, and comfort with working around tech debt is expected.
The Principal Software Engineer will work on Motion's highest impact projects and have ownership over major parts of the product code. They will be responsible for implementing large software projects to help Motion scale and will contribute to initiatives on the product roadmap that deliver significant value to customers. The role involves working intensely, learning fast, and helping redefine how work gets done.
AI platform for optimizing time management
Motion provides a platform that uses artificial intelligence to help users manage their time more effectively. The service automates scheduling and prioritizes tasks, allowing users to save time and reduce stress in their daily routines. By focusing on high-performing professionals like CEOs and founders, Motion addresses the needs of individuals with busy schedules and overwhelming to-do lists. Unlike many competitors, Motion offers a subscription-based model that includes a free trial, making it accessible for both individuals and teams. Users can experience significant time savings, reportedly gaining back up to 2 hours each day, which enhances their productivity and allows them to focus on more important tasks. The goal of Motion is to optimize time management for its users, helping them achieve a better work-life balance.